Output 51d0e3ff650f4d13263fa00aae581a5ce3a6ab8c858e4aa49ff66bbe02ecfade:0

value
665995
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85f5f825a01f0d27a8ebb0cea969352c40873a93 OP_EQUALVERIFY OP_CHECKSIG
address
1DDKXmBMNzBvCJTG7zk2gzYd2y31r1Pqca
transaction
51d0e3ff650f4d13263fa00aae581a5ce3a6ab8c858e4aa49ff66bbe02ecfade
confirmations
462748
spent
true